Handover Note — Franchise Agreement, Varnell Trading Co.

To the board: I am transferring oversight of the Quillbrook franchise agreement to Director Masten effective month-end. Terms with the Arlow Hollow operator are at final draft; royalty tiers agreed, territory map pending legal sign-off. Outstanding items: fit-out cost split and renewal clause duration. Masten will close both within three weeks and report at the next session. Context on the wider strategy follows below.

internal memo for faweg-tafog: Only 7 of the 100 pilot accounts renewed Quenael, so a churn review is set for April 15.

This PR updates the chip-read ingestion path for the Stridemark timing system used at the Calbury Marathon. Previously, duplicate reads from overlapping mats were deduplicated in the results service, which added latency at the finish line. Dedup now happens at the reader gateway, keyed on chip ID and mat window. New team members: the only part you'll likely touch is the tuning block, since window sizes vary per course. The current constants are listed below.

limits module of tafop-hahop:
WEIGHTS = {
    "julmir": 223,
    "belox": 987,
    "lamion": 470,
    "pelath": 609,
    "fraok": 1010,
    "eliion": 343,
    "drudor": 342,
}

## Releases

The Bouncewright bounce processor ships as a single container built by the `relcut` pipeline. Before tagging, confirm the suppression-list migration has run in staging, because the processor refuses to start against an older schema and will requeue every bounce event indefinitely. Version numbers follow calendar versioning; hotfixes append a letter. Each release image must be signed prior to pushing to the Harvane registry. The signing key used for all release images is below.

deploy key for yagap-kawig: bky4_Q8dK

### v3.2.0 — Renamed setting

Keyspindle no longer reads `KS_ROTATE_TOKEN`; it was renamed for consistency with the plugin API. Plugins targeting 3.2+ must use the new name or rotation hooks will not fire. The old name is ignored silently — no deprecation warning is emitted. Update your `.env` before upgrading. Keep `KS_PLUGIN_DIR` and `KS_LOG_LEVEL` as-is. Immediately after those entries, add the renamed token line with your existing value.

secret setting of kawif-kajef: COURIER_KEY3=d2b